linux-stable/drivers/net/usb
Oleksij Rempel 4a2c7217cd net: usb: asix: ax88772: manage PHY PM from MAC
Take over PHY power management, otherwise PHY framework will try to
access ASIX MDIO bus before MAC resume was completed.

Fixes: e532a096be ("net: usb: asix: ax88772: add phylib support")
Signed-off-by: Oleksij Rempel <o.rempel@pengutronix.de>
Reported-by: Marek Szyprowski <m.szyprowski@samsung.com>
Reported-by: Jon Hunter <jonathanh@nvidia.com>
Suggested-by: Heiner Kallweit <hkallweit1@gmail.com>
Tested-by: Jon Hunter <jonathanh@nvidia.com>
Tested-by: Marek Szyprowski <m.szyprowski@samsung.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
2021-06-11 13:00:31 -07:00
..
aqc111.c
aqc111.h
asix.h net: usb: asix: ax88772: add generic selftest support 2021-06-07 13:23:02 -07:00
asix_common.c net: usb: asix: add error handling for asix_mdio_* functions 2021-06-07 13:23:02 -07:00
asix_devices.c net: usb: asix: ax88772: manage PHY PM from MAC 2021-06-11 13:00:31 -07:00
ax88172a.c net: usb: asix: ax88772: Fix less than zero comparison of a u16 2021-06-09 14:54:03 -07:00
ax88179_178a.c net: usb: ax88179_178a: initialize local variables before use 2021-04-01 16:09:37 -07:00
catc.c
cdc-phonet.c net: cdc-phonet: fix data-interface release on probe failure 2021-03-18 19:45:37 -07:00
cdc_eem.c net: cdc_eem: fix URL to CDC EEM 1.0 spec 2021-05-14 15:17:18 -07:00
cdc_ether.c net: usb: Fix spelling mistakes 2021-06-01 17:05:05 -07:00
cdc_mbim.c net: usb: Fix spelling mistakes 2021-06-01 17:05:05 -07:00
cdc_ncm.c net: usb: Fix spelling mistakes 2021-06-01 17:05:05 -07:00
cdc_subset.c
ch9200.c
cx82310_eth.c cx82310_eth: fix error return code in cx82310_bind() 2020-11-16 15:23:44 -08:00
dm9601.c usbnet: add _mii suffix to usbnet_set/get_link_ksettings 2021-04-06 16:22:36 -07:00
gl620a.c
hso.c Merge git://git.kernel.org/pub/scm/linux/kernel/git/netdev/net 2021-05-27 09:55:10 -07:00
huawei_cdc_ncm.c usb: class: cdc-wdm: WWAN framework integration 2021-05-11 16:17:56 -07:00
int51x1.c net: usb: Fix spelling mistakes 2021-06-01 17:05:05 -07:00
ipheth.c usbnet: ipheth: fix connectivity with iOS 14 2020-11-21 14:01:34 -08:00
kalmia.c
kaweth.c
Kconfig net: usb: asix: ax88772: add generic selftest support 2021-06-07 13:23:02 -07:00
lan78xx.c net: usb: Fix spelling mistakes 2021-06-01 17:05:05 -07:00
lan78xx.h
lg-vl600.c net: usb: Fix spelling mistakes 2021-06-01 17:05:05 -07:00
Makefile r8153_ecm: avoid to be prior to r8152 driver 2020-11-19 08:23:46 -08:00
mcs7830.c net: usb: remove leading spaces before tabs 2021-05-20 15:10:57 -07:00
net1080.c
pegasus.c net: usb: pegasus: use new tasklet API 2021-02-02 15:51:18 -08:00
pegasus.h
plusb.c
qmi_wwan.c usb: class: cdc-wdm: WWAN framework integration 2021-05-11 16:17:56 -07:00
r8152.c net: usb: Fix spelling mistakes 2021-06-01 17:05:05 -07:00
r8153_ecm.c r8153_ecm: Add Lenovo Powered USB-C Hub as a fallback of r8152 2021-01-12 20:00:51 -08:00
rndis_host.c net: usb: Fix spelling mistakes 2021-06-01 17:05:05 -07:00
rtl8150.c net: usb: rtl8150: use new tasklet API 2021-02-02 15:51:18 -08:00
sierra_net.c usbnet: add _mii suffix to usbnet_set/get_link_ksettings 2021-04-06 16:22:36 -07:00
smsc75xx.c net: usb: fix memory leak in smsc75xx_bind 2021-05-24 14:26:25 -07:00
smsc75xx.h
smsc95xx.c
smsc95xx.h
sr9700.c usbnet: add _mii suffix to usbnet_set/get_link_ksettings 2021-04-06 16:22:36 -07:00
sr9700.h
sr9800.c usbnet: add _mii suffix to usbnet_set/get_link_ksettings 2021-04-06 16:22:36 -07:00
sr9800.h
usbnet.c usbnet: run unbind() before unregister_netdev() 2021-06-07 13:23:02 -07:00
zaurus.c